Phrasal verbs are a unique aspect of the English language, combining a verb with a preposition or adverb to create a new meaning. This list of phrasal verbs that include 5-letter words with ‘H’ is a resourceful tool for teachers to help students understand and apply these expressions in everyday communication. Each phrasal verb is an opportunity to enhance language skills and add versatility to speech. Here are 30 phrasal verbs, each with a short explanation:

  1. Hatch out – To emerge from an egg or situation.
  2. Heap up – To accumulate or gather together.
  3. Heel in – To temporarily plant in soil.
  4. Held on – To grasp tightly; persist.
  5. Hem in – To surround and restrict movement.
  6. Herd in – To gather and move a group.
  7. Hike up – To pull or lift upwards.
  8. Hold up – To delay or rob.
  9. Hole up – To hide or seclude oneself.
  10. Home in – To move or aim towards a target.
  11. Hone in – To focus or perfect something.
  12. Hook up – To connect or assemble.
  13. Hoot at – To deride or mock.
  14. Hope for – To wish for something.
  15. Horse around – To play around or be silly.
  16. Huddle up – To gather closely together.
  17. Huff off – To leave in a mood of anger.
  18. Hurry up – To speed up an action.
  19. Hush up – To keep something secret.
  20. Hustle up – To move or act quickly.
  21. Hitch up – To fasten or attach.
  22. Heap on – To add in large amounts.
  23. Hedge in – To limit or restrict.
  24. Hawk up – To clear the throat noisily.
  25. Heave to – To stop a vessel’s progress.
  26. Hone in – To refine or perfect.
  27. Hush up – To keep quiet about something.
  28. Hitch on – To attach or connect.
  29. Hold off – To delay or postpone.
  30. Hunch over – To bend one’s body forward.
